International Migration, Integration and Social Cohesion in Europe (IMISCOE) is the premier network of scholars working in the area of European migration and integration. It was founded in 2004 with funding from the European Commission. In 2014, IMISCOE was taken over by Erasmus University Rotterdam, in the Netherlands, and is currently composed of 35 research institutes dedicated to the fields of migration, integration and diversity.
